Flag
Date Adopted: 2005
Description: The flag of the Tambov Oblast has a rectangular panel consisting of two equal vertical bands of red and blue, and two-sided coat of arms of Tambov region in the full version with the crown and ribbon. Red is a symbol of courage, fortitude, courage, residents of the area, a reflection of their generosity, the desire for unity and solidarity, continuity of generations, like the color of the historic flags of Russia, Tambov regimental emblems and flags of the Soviet period. The color blue means greatness, natural beauty and purity of the Tambov Oblast, faithful to his tradition, perfection and well-being.

It`s the world-wide famous march during World War I, created by Vassliy Ivanovich Agapkin in 1912-13. Agapkin was a trumpeter in 7th Reserve Cavalry Regiment. The march was inspired by the First Balkan War. In Red Army was not popular until 40s. It was VERY popular in the White Army durung Civil War in Russia (1918-1922).
The march was played for the first time for public at 7th Reserve Cavalry Regiment parade in Tambov City in 1912. That`s why it is the anthem of Tambov oblast.)
